Automotive Club Insightful Event, “Hybrid And Electrical Vehicles”

January 23

The Automotive Club at Mohan Babu University organized an event titled “Hybrid and Electrical Vehicles” on 23rd January 2025 from 10.45 A.M to 11.30 A.M at the CAM LAB. The primary objective of this event was to assess and enhance participants’ knowledge of hybrid and electric vehicle components, functions, and principles.

The event was coordinated and conducted by the faculty coordinator, M. Ramesh Naik (Mechanical Engineering, Polytechnic). The event attracted 32 students, divided into 8 batches, who actively participated in a series of challenging rounds designed to test their understanding of modern automotive technologies.

The competition was structured into two rounds, each focusing on different aspects of hybrid and electrical vehicle knowledge. In the First round, participants were shown images of various components used in hybrid and electric vehicles. They were required to correctly identify the components and explain their functions. This round tested both theoretical knowledge and visual recognition skills of the participants. The second round required participants to provide precise and detailed answers to technical questions without any external aids. This round was designed to evaluate their conceptual understanding and ability to recall crucial information under time constraints. Following the two rounds of rigorous competition, the top two batches were identified based on their performance and were awarded the titles of Winner and Runner-up of the event. The event provided an excellent platform for students to showcase their knowledge and sharpen their analytical skills related to hybrid and electric vehicle technologies.

The “Hybrid and Electrical Vehicles” event was a resounding success, fostering enthusiasm and curiosity among students regarding the advancements in automotive technology. The event not only provided an opportunity for learning but also encouraged healthy competition among participants.
